On January 31, 2016, I had breakfast at this hotel. It is conveniently located right in front of Tsutenkaku Tower. I stayed in a non-smoking twin room on a Saturday night, which cost 9,504 yen for one night. I forgot my membership card, so I didn't get the 5% discount that I should have received. I have stayed at various Toyoko Inns before, in places like Asakusa in Tokyo, Mishima in Shizuoka, Wakayama, Miebashi in Okinawa, Shijo-Karasuma in Kyoto, and Shijo-Omiya in Kyoto, and I have always enjoyed their complimentary breakfast services. However, this time the breakfast was disappointing. It consisted of meatballs, simmered hijiki seaweed, cabbage, scrambled eggs, rice, miso soup, coffee, and orange juice. The orange juice ran out by 8:15 am and they refused to refill it. Overall, the breakfast was not delicious. The meatballs tasted like they were made from frozen food. The location is great, but since I stayed in Osaka, I was hoping for something more Osaka-like, such as takoyaki. I hope they make more effort to improve their breakfast offerings.
